From 394719a909324cd6361eb6a9077e4a66a5e42433 Mon Sep 17 00:00:00 2001 From: Oskari Alaranta Date: Wed, 15 Apr 2026 16:06:47 +0300 Subject: [PATCH] userspace: Fix some includes found when compiling to linux --- userspace/libraries/LibFont/Font.cpp | 3 +++ userspace/libraries/LibGUI/Window.cpp | 1 + userspace/libraries/LibImage/Image.cpp | 2 ++ userspace/libraries/LibInput/KeyboardLayout.cpp | 1 + userspace/programs/Terminal/Terminal.cpp | 2 ++ userspace/programs/WindowServer/main.cpp | 3 +++ 6 files changed, 12 insertions(+) diff --git a/userspace/libraries/LibFont/Font.cpp b/userspace/libraries/LibFont/Font.cpp index d7ebc327..84467d71 100644 --- a/userspace/libraries/LibFont/Font.cpp +++ b/userspace/libraries/LibFont/Font.cpp @@ -8,6 +8,9 @@ #endif #include +#include +#include +#include #if __is_kernel extern uint8_t _binary_font_prefs_psf_start[]; diff --git a/userspace/libraries/LibGUI/Window.cpp b/userspace/libraries/LibGUI/Window.cpp index f633bb9a..b4172f70 100644 --- a/userspace/libraries/LibGUI/Window.cpp +++ b/userspace/libraries/LibGUI/Window.cpp @@ -9,6 +9,7 @@ #include #include #include +#include #include #include diff --git a/userspace/libraries/LibImage/Image.cpp b/userspace/libraries/LibImage/Image.cpp index 18005fb5..d5a07b17 100644 --- a/userspace/libraries/LibImage/Image.cpp +++ b/userspace/libraries/LibImage/Image.cpp @@ -7,6 +7,8 @@ #include #include +#include +#include #include diff --git a/userspace/libraries/LibInput/KeyboardLayout.cpp b/userspace/libraries/LibInput/KeyboardLayout.cpp index 1a0a60e5..c3fa618e 100644 --- a/userspace/libraries/LibInput/KeyboardLayout.cpp +++ b/userspace/libraries/LibInput/KeyboardLayout.cpp @@ -11,6 +11,7 @@ #include #include #include +#include #endif #include diff --git a/userspace/programs/Terminal/Terminal.cpp b/userspace/programs/Terminal/Terminal.cpp index e62266ca..e1bd317d 100644 --- a/userspace/programs/Terminal/Terminal.cpp +++ b/userspace/programs/Terminal/Terminal.cpp @@ -7,9 +7,11 @@ #include #include +#include #include #include #include +#include #include static constexpr uint32_t s_colors_dark[] { diff --git a/userspace/programs/WindowServer/main.cpp b/userspace/programs/WindowServer/main.cpp index 1e5eb817..41bd7e8c 100644 --- a/userspace/programs/WindowServer/main.cpp +++ b/userspace/programs/WindowServer/main.cpp @@ -7,6 +7,8 @@ #include #include +#include +#include #include #include #include @@ -14,6 +16,7 @@ #include #include #include +#include #include struct Config